The lien is with the lender’s security. If the homeowner defaults over the mortgage, the lien lets the lender to repossess the property.

Furthermore, anybody using a home finance loan has an encumbrance in the shape of the lien against their house. Nevertheless, the encumbrance doesn’t impact the situation Unless of course the homeowner fails to pay for their house loan or is providing their house for substantially a lot less than their remaining financial loan stability, which can be rare.

These stipulations are often called Covenants, Problems and Restrictions (CC&R). CC&R are Component of the deed, so they can't be disregarded by homeowners. Therefore, failure to adjust to CC&R can cause your HOA positioning a lien on your property.

HOA policies can restrict a homeowner’s decisions in several approaches. As an example, your CC&R may protect against you from roofing your property with a specific product or painting your house a particular color. Also, some HOAs limit what kind of pet you may hold in the home or forbid all f Animals.
